What two factors affects the climate of NW Europe?
Several factors affect climate in Northwestern Europe. These factors include the presence of the Alps and the location of the subregion near or along large bodies of water. The winter storms that originate over the North Atlantic Ocean also affect Northwestern Europe’s climate.

How does climate change affect Europe?
Climate change is likely to increase the frequency of flooding across Europe in the coming years. Heavy rainstorms are projected to become more common and more intense due to higher temperatures, with flash floods expected to become more frequent across Europe.

Which of the following crops is grown in Europe’s Mediterranean climate?
The most relevant crops of this kind of systems are permanent crops, such as olives, grapes, citrus and nuts which most of their global production is located in areas with a Mediterranean climate.

What are Europe’s six climate regions?
There are many different climate zones found in Europe. These include the Marine West Coast climate zone, the Humid Continental climate zone, the Mediterranean climate zone, the Subarctic and Tundra climate zone, and the Highland climate zone.
